Purpose: Develop creative concepts, design market leading products and appropriate high value innovations, which improve brand competitiveness through design and product leadership, and enables adidas to deliver added value to consumers and athletes. Key Responsibilities: Develop in cooperation with appropriate ait project Team(s), relevant technologies, construction ideas and patterns through samples ensuring function and manufacturability. Create stories, explore and develop new performance innovations, and incorporate research results in building unique market leading product design and concepts, which are based on athletes` and consumers` needs. Be at the global forefront of design trends, and be innovative in their application. Own and Co-ordinate the creative process to make sure that the final products meet both ait and BU commercial and image objectives. Execute, lead and drive defined project(s) creatively via ait Design. Collaborate with In-Line(as needed) to ensure innovations are integrated into ranges and long term product plans. Ensure sufficient service to product management and development. Essential Duties Responsibilities: Translate ait and BU strategies by acting as the performance innovation conscience for the company, defining and incorporating Technologies into differentiated and distinctive design languages to fulfil or exceed our customers` expectations. Design (this includes concept exploration, concept illustration, hand sketches, renderings, technical drawings and "techpacks", colour concepts, story boards, graphic solutions, etc...) Collect and share relevant information needed to effectively design, inform and inspire. This should include all possible sources to gain this information: - Trade publications, trade fairs, sport events general interest press, trend services, fashion sportswear magazines store checks, market visits, team travel professional and amateur athletes, as well as your own expertise universities, internal and external researchers manufacturing process and material developments Communicate effectively with internal and external resources to maintain product development efficiency, submit all relevant information needed for the development process such as sketches, detail sketches and sections, fabrics, colour-ways and artwork... Travel as needed to solve design and development issues at the respective factories and development centres.
